About us

About us

Local policing teams are groups of officers dedicated to serving the community. Teams are made up of officers based in the area, supported by additional officers from the wider area. 

Teams work closely with local authorities, organisations, partners and residents to decide policing priorities. This helps teams find long-term solutions to local problems.

Policing priorities

  • Priority:

    Action taken:

  • Priority:

    Anti-social behaviour in reported hotspot areas across Berkhamsted and Tring.

    Issued 01 May 2026

    Action taken:

    • Patrols are being carried out.
    • Businesses and partner agencies have been liaised with.
    • Crime prevention stands and engagement events have been held to provide a visible presence.
    • Offenders have been identified, with appropriate action taken.
    • Officers have visited local schools.
    • Operational work is ongoing behind the scenes to identify further offenders.

    Actioned 01 July 2026
